We are pleased to present the first digital issue of NewsNet, which will be exclusively digital moving forward and published in six bi-monthly issues per year instead of five.

NewsNet is now interactive and flippable, full color, more easily read on on phones and small devices, and environmentally friendly. Blue text and most images are clickable. You can share NewsNet in its entirety or from particular pages.

The January 2022 issue of NewsNet includes: the 2021 President's Address, "The Implications of Our 2021 Theme: Diversity, Intersectionality, and Interdisciplinarity," by Sibelan Forrester (Swarthmore College); "Creative Horizons: Art in the Post-Soviet Era," by Kristen Ho (Arizona State University); "Five Minutes with Archie Brown, Winner of the 2021 Pushkin House Book Prize," by Andrew Jack (Financial Times); Annual Report from the ASEEES executive director and other reports on ASEEES programs, an advocacy statement related to the Memorial Society, acknowledgements of our generous annual donors and of the 2021 Affiliate Group prizes winners, and all of our usual features.
